Deliveroo Expands Dublin Service

Premium food delivery service Deliveroo has expanded its reach from Dublin 2, 4 and 6 to Dublin 7, 8 and 9, as well as Stillorgan and Dundrum, with plans to launch in Dun Laoghaire this summer.

Launched in London in 2013 and established in Dublin early this year, Deliveroo provides delivery solutions for popular restaurants to reach consumer’s doors, working with businesses that don’t have an in-house delivery service.

Last April, the service was named as one of Forbes’ '25 Billion-Dollar Start-ups', followed by winning best E-Commerce Start-up in Europe at the first Europas event.

Speaking on the brand's success, country manager at Deliveroo, Anis Harb said, "The demand for the Deliveroo service is testament to the fact that Irish people want quality food delivered from their favourite restaurants, and fast."

Harb added that the upcoming launch of the Deliveroo iOS app is set to make that user experience better for time-poor consumers, and explained, “By using proprietary technology, its [Deliveroo] bring the meals of restaurants that customers love to their door in 32 minutes on average.”
